Fey, and Arcadia, and the grammar of things are at the core of Amal El-Mohtar’s The River Has Roots. The threads that connect them all are the roots that bind two sisters together. Esther and Ysabel Hawthorne tend to the enchanted willows that feed off The River Liss, whose waters travel freely between mortal lands and Arcadia.
